Lot 248 | A PAIR OF NEOCLASSICAL GREY-VEINED MARBLE VASES
Valeur estimée
£ 6 000 – 10 000
LATE 18TH CENTURY, PROBABLY NORTH EUROPEAN
Each of monumental amphora shape, with everted rim, flanked by ram's head handles, holding garlands of roses resting on a spreading socle and square base, each on later reconstituted square stone pedestal
Each vase 42 1/8 in. (107 cm.) high; 27 in. (69 cm.) wide, each base 35 in. (89 cm.) high; 23 in. (58.5 cm.) wide
